Allow full control of phone number formatting (prevent Web View override)

Organizations need the ability to define and maintain their own phone number formatting standards, including the option to leave formatting set to “none.”

Currently, formatting set at the database level can be overridden in Web View, which introduces inconsistencies. This impacts:

  • Record matching and lookup reliability

  • Overall data consistency

  • Reporting, especially when additional system-driven phone types (e.g., international variants) are introduced

  • For organizations managing both domestic and international constituents, a single, internally defined format is often preferred over multiple system-imposed formats.

    Request:

  • Respect database-level formatting choices in all interfaces, including Web View

  • Allow formatting rules to be independent of phone type

  • Ensure formatting consistency supports matching, lookup, and reporting functions
